Chainalysis, a leading crypto analytics firm, has proposed standardized protocols for blockchain fund tracing, aiming to enhance transparency and regulatory compliance. The initiative, announced this week, addresses gaps in existing tools by introducing a unified framework for tracking digital asset flows across multiple blockchains.
The Technical Underpinnings of Chainalysis’ Proposal
Chainalysis’ whitepaper outlines a modular architecture designed to parse on-chain data from Ethereum, Bitcoin, and Layer-2 solutions. The system leverages a centralized indexer, dubbed “TraceNet,” which aggregates transaction graphs using graph databases. According to the firm, TraceNet reduces query latency by 40% compared to legacy tools like Etherscan’s API, though benchmarks remain unpublished.
“The core innovation lies in the probabilistic matching engine,” explained Dr. Lena Choi, a cryptography researcher at MIT. “By cross-referencing UTXO (Unspent Transaction Output) patterns with heuristic clustering, it achieves 89% accuracy in linking addresses to real-world entities.” This approach contrasts with traditional methods that rely on KYC (Know Your Customer) data, which is often incomplete.
Implications for the Crypto Ecosystem
The proposal has sparked debate within open-source communities. Developers at the Ethereum Foundation raised concerns about centralization risks, noting that TraceNet’s reliance on a proprietary database could create vendor lock-in. “Decentralized alternatives like Graph Protocol’s subgraphs already offer similar capabilities,” said developer Nick Vyas. “What Chainalysis is proposing risks entrenching a single point of failure.”

However, compliance officers at major exchanges view the standards as a potential lifeline. “Regulators are demanding actionable insights, not just raw data,” stated Sarah Lin, head of compliance at Binance. “A universal tracing framework could streamline reporting obligations across jurisdictions.”

Regulatory and Security Considerations
The initiative aligns with the EU’s Markets in Crypto-Assets (MiCA) regulation, which mandates “transparent and traceable” transactions. However, privacy advocates warn of overreach. “Tracing every transaction could enable mass surveillance,” argued Rebecca Moore, a cybersecurity lawyer at EFF. “Without strict oversight, this framework risks becoming a tool for authoritarian control.”
From a technical standpoint, Chainalysis’ system is vulnerable to Sybil attacks if malicious actors spoof UTXO patterns. The firm acknowledges this risk but cites “multi-layered anomaly detection” as a mitigation strategy. Independent tests by the OpenChain project, however, found that 12% of simulated attacks bypassed initial filters.
